Imaging Services Coordinator

At the direction of the Diagnostic Imaging Leadership and radiologists, works within one or more specialties or procedural settings and is responsible for coordinating the activities, documentation and transfer of information related to scheduling and preparing the patient for in-department appointments for procedures and/or related testing. Coordinates schedules and acts as liaison between relevant offices, departments, external resources, and individuals to achieve appropriate preparation arrangements.  Assumes the responsibility for the delivery of complete customer service and maximum productivity in the delivery of radiology images and results.  Understand and use a network of computerized systems for processing information and for archiving and retrieving image studies. Comprehend workflows required for the use of radiology images throughout a broad customer base internally and externally.

Minimum Education

High School Diploma or equivalent. Associates Degree in related field preferred. Basic Anatomy & Physiology desireable.

 Minimum Work Experience

2 years medical-related office. Prior experience with direct clinical patient care such as LNA, MA, EMT or related field. Experience working in a high-volume environment with competing priorities. 

 Required Skills, Knowledge, and Abilities

Demonstrated strong knowledge of medical terminology. Demonstrated strong knowledge of advanced computer skills. Excellent verbal and written communication and interpersonal skills. Highly discreet, able to routinely handle confidential materials. Demonstrated ability to manage multiple priorities and assignments. Demonstrated experience in successfully supporting peer staff members in improvement initiatives. Demonstrated problem solving-skills and critical thinking. Strong customer service skills.
